Tailored to you

Facelift options with Dr. Martin

Mini Facelift

A shorter-scar approach for early jawline and jowl laxity, with a quicker recovery.

Deep Plane Facelift

Repositions deeper facial layers for the most natural, long-lasting lift.

Comprehensive Facelift

Addresses the midface, jawline, and neck together for full-face harmony.

Revision Facelift

Refines or restores results from a previous facelift performed elsewhere.

Getting ready

Preparing for surgery

  • Complete pre-operative medical clearance
  • Pause blood-thinning medications as directed
  • Arrange a ride and first-night caregiver
  • Fill prescriptions and prep your recovery space
  • Stop nicotine well before your date
  • Set up easy meals and loose, button-front tops
